Friday, November 30, 2018

All of the starlight ever produced by the observable universe measured

From their laboratories on a rocky planet dwarfed by the vastness of space, scientists have collaborated to measure all of the starlight ever produced throughout the history of the observable universe.

from Latest Science News -- ScienceDaily https://ift.tt/2zxp229

No comments:

Post a Comment

They fled the flames—now jaguars rule a wetland refuge

After devastating wildfires scorched the Brazilian Pantanal, an unexpected phenomenon unfolded—more jaguars began arriving at a remote wetla...